Default Sparks X-6 jetting?

I just ordered the X-6 complete exhaust for my 400EX. I planned on putting a 42 pilot jet, and taking the choke out. What should my main be? I plan on running a uni air filter with the lid off. Everything else is stock. Thanks!

Default Sparks X-6 jetting?

temperature and altitude will make a big difference. where i live right now, it is 625feet above sea level and the temps are about 45 degrees. i am running a 158 with the lid on. i would run a 160 or 162 with the lid off. i do have a built motor but that didn't change jetting too much. removing the lid would change it more. let me know your elevation and temperature your riding in.

Default Sparks X-6 jetting?

you won't have to rejet for summer but i highly recommend it. maybe i just do it because i am **** about jetting. i usually rejet the main 2 or 3 times a year depending on a few factors. for that temp and altitude and the x-6, filter, and no lid i would try a 160 or 162 main. see how it runs. by the way, that is if your are going to buy keihin jets. dynojets or the jets that come in a jet kit have a different numbering pattern so a 150 keihin is NOT a 150 dynojet. i tried to send you a private message and it said Ole doesn't exist or you do not want to recieve message. try to get that so you can recieve private messages and i can give you some very helpful tips.
